End of Unit 3 Celebration
On March 20, our co-op held it's third End of Unit Celebration of the year! Since we studied Plymouth and the very first Thanksgiving this quarter, we decided to make this Unit Celebration a Thanksgiving Feast! And, wow, did we ever have a feast!! Turkey, ham, potatoes, yams, stuffing, cranberries, rolls and many yummy desserts filled the buffet table. After feasting together, the kids performed their memory work for the quarter--the older kids recited a quotation from William Bradford, while the FIAR class showed off the Bible verses they had memorized. Then the Upper Grammar class took center stage. All quarter long, they have been working on a play about Jamestown called, "Who Wants to Be a Colonist." It was a hilarious game show where two contestants competed with their knowledge of the Jamestown colony. Finally, the kids had a chance to show off the work they have completed all quarter long, as the families visited with the kids at their tables filled with projects, books and completed assignments.
